Forest clearance services involve the professional removal of trees, shrubs, and underbrush from a designated area. This process is essential for preparing land for various uses, such as construction projects, landscaping, or property expansion. Service providers typically use specialized equipment and techniques to safely and efficiently clear the site, ensuring that the area is free of obstructions and ready for its next purpose. Clearing a forested or heavily wooded property can be complex, requiring expertise to handle different types of vegetation and terrain.

These services help solve common problems associated with overgrown or unmanaged land. For homeowners, this might mean removing trees that pose safety hazards, such as those at risk of falling or damaged by disease. It can also address issues related to blocked views, limited sunlight, or difficulty maintaining the property. Additionally, forest clearance can be necessary before installing new structures, creating open spaces for recreation, or preventing pests and invasive species from spreading. Professional clearance ensures the work is done safely and in accordance with local regulations.

Properties that often utilize forest clearance services include rural homes surrounded by extensive woodland, properties undergoing development or renovation, and landowners seeking to improve their outdoor space. Even urban properties with overgrown yards or neglected wooded areas may benefit from professional clearing. These services are suitable for both large plots of land and smaller sections that require targeted removal of trees and vegetation. Homeowners considering expansion, landscaping, or safety improvements are common clients for this type of work.

The overview below groups typical Forest Clearance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Issaquah,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small-Scale Clearance - Typical costs for clearing small groups of trees or shrubs range from $250-$600 for many routine jobs. Many local contractors handle these projects efficiently within this range, but costs can vary based on tree size and site conditions.

Medium Projects - Larger, more complex clearance jobs, such as removing multiple trees or dense vegetation, often fall between $1,000-$3,000. These projects are common in residential areas and can include site preparation for construction.

Large or Commercial Jobs - Extensive forest clearance or land preparation for development can cost $5,000-$15,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ent but require specialized equipment and planning, influencing the higher end of the cost spectrum.

Additional Factors - Costs can vary depending on factors like tree size, access, and site complexity. Many projects land in the middle ranges, but unusually large or difficult jobs may push costs higher, depending on specific site conditions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
